Art of the Pickup
It isn't a matter of chance. You need to be in the right place on the right night, wear the right uniform and order the right drink. Here, an insider's guide to getting lucky By Karen Steward
Image credit: Jeffrey Decoster
Leafs and Jays Fans
Natural Habitat Game nights at Peel Pub.
Dress Code Sports jersey, ball cap, face paint, foam finger.
Libation Beer ’n’ wings.
The Mating Ritual His ’n’ hers season tickets followed by a surprise proposal on the Jumbotron.
Shiny People
Natural Habitat Dinner at Sotto Sotto followed by drinks at the Century Room.
Dress Code Next season’s Gucci, accessorized by a deep tan and sparkling white teeth.
Libation A shot of liquid cocaine (Goldschlager and Jägermeister).
The Mating Ritual Brief fling in the presidential suite at the Four Seasons until one has to take off to L.A. on business.
Indie Rockers
Natural Habitat Kensington’s The Boat, in the wee hours of Sunday morning.
Dress Code Vans, vintage finds, ironic tees, skinny jeans.
Libation Labatt 50.
The Mating Ritual Regular front-row attendance at Broken Social Scene concerts.
Trust Fund Socialites
Natural Habitat The Spoke Club.
Dress Code Whatever the personal shopper at Holt’s picked out.
Libation Gin martini.
The Mating Ritual A week-long fling in South Beach.
Cougars
Natural Habitat Crocodile Rock for 911 Wednesdays (VIP night for emergency response personnel).
Dress Code The three Rs: red lipstick, rouge and Restylane.
Libation White wine spritzer.
The Mating Ritual Showing off latest arm candy found during frosh week.
